    1/2 c. pinon nuts 1/2 c. sunflower seeds 1/4 t. salt Grind raw nuts and seeds together, add salt and form into small balls. Flatten between palms into thin wafers. Wrap each wafer in a soft corn husk (or aluminum foil). Bake at 350 degrees for 40-50 minutes
